Chelsea News: Mourinho wants Didier Drogba to return to Stamford Bridge. Drogba could return to Chelsea if Galatasaray face Chelsea in the round of 16 of Champions League.

Chelsea Manager Jose Mourinho is hoping Chelsea to be drawn with the Turkish giants Galatasaray in the round of 16 of the Champions League on Monday that will bring his former player Didier Drogba back to Stamford Bridge.



Drogba left Chelsea for Chinese side Shanghai Shenhua after enjoying his successful eight years at Stamford Bridge. Drogba played only 11 games for the Chinese side scoring 8 goals before moving to Turkey to sign for Galatasaray.

Galatasaray recently secured round of 16 spot of Champions League by beating the Italian giants Juventus in the last group stage match.

The 35 year old scored 157 goals in 341 appearances for Chelsea plus won lot of trophies including Primer League, Champions League and FA Cup.

Chelsea fans still considered him as a hero because he played an important part in the club's Champions League victory against German side Bayern Munich in 2012 when he scored the winning penalty in a dramatic shoot-out at Allianz Arena, Munich.

Chelsea could play against Galatasaray, Zenit St Petersburg or AC Milan who are totally out of form this season, in the last 16, rather than the inform teams like Real Madrid, Barcelona or defending champions Bayern Munich, but Mourinho said that whoever they face it would be difficult. If it is Galatasaray then they have King Drogba.

Mourinho said that they will wait for the result of the draw and forget about the Champions League as it will continue in February.

Chelsea will prepare for the next stage of the Champions League by producing the best in the domestic competitions.
If they qualify for quarter-final then there will be only eight teams. They can think in a different way.
